Lloyd S. Peck
About
Lloyd S. Peck has authored 246 papers that have received a total of 10.3k indexed citations.
This includes 162 papers in Oceanography, 155 papers in Ecology and 140 papers in Global and Planetary Change. The topics of these papers are Marine Bivalve and Aquaculture Studies (118 papers), Physiological and biochemical adaptations (94 papers) and Marine Biology and Ecology Research (83 papers). Lloyd S. Peck is often cited by papers focused on Marine Bivalve and Aquaculture Studies (118 papers), Physiological and biochemical adaptations (94 papers) and Marine Biology and Ecology Research (83 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Germany and United States. Lloyd S. Peck's co-authors include Melody S. Clark, Simon A. Morley, Andrew Clarke, Michael A. S. Thorne and Hans‐Otto Pörtner and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Science and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ences
